Since 1775, Kuwait has shared strong links and a valued friendship with the UK. We're continuing this tradition with our scholarship schemes, and alumni groups such as KABA.
What does KABA offer?
It holds cultural and social events for members and their children. These provide many opportunities to exchange news and views on the business scene in Kuwait and to share experiences with other UK graduates. It also provides a forum for new Kuwaiti graduates from UK institutions, offering an introduction to business.
KABA has the following aims:
•to promote mutual understanding and a cordial relationship between Kuwait and Britain through education, culture and business activities
•to provide opportunities to exchange news and views on the business scene in Kuwait
•to promote a forum for communication and for the introduction of new Kuwaiti graduates from British institutions
Who can join?
The Kuwaiti Association of British Alumni is open to Kuwaiti Chevening scholars and Kuwaiti students who have graduated from any UK institution.
